Problem

Existing television services using digital broadcasting technologies face limitations in processing and delivering broadcast data across various transmission protocols, including wired and wireless networks, and Internet Protocol (IP) protocols, without seamless integration and content protection.

Innovation Solution

A host device interfacing with a Point Of Deployment (POD) that processes broadcast data by receiving IP packets, routing them based on destination information, extracting Transport Stream (TS) packets, adding identification headers, and multiplexing them for transmission, while also supporting conditional access using conventional cable cards and receiving data from Multimedia over Coax Alliance (MoCA) networks.

Data Source

PatentUS7944916B2Host device interfacing with a point of deployment (POD) and a method of processing broadcast data
Publication Date: 2011.05.17 LG ELECTRONICS INC

A host device interfacing with a point of deployment (POD) and method of processing broadcasting data are disclosed. An IP physical interface unit receives a frame including an internet protocol (IP) packet carrying broadcast data through a network modem. A routing engine routs the frame based on a destination information included in the frame. An IP to TS Decapsulator extracts a MPEG-2 TS packet from the IP packet included in the routed frame. And a multiplexer augments the extracted MPEG-2 TS packet with Packet Header carrying an identification information, multiplexes the augmented MPEG-2 TS packet and forwards the multiplexed MPEG-2 TS to the POD.
